Warning Signs You Need Emergency Water Removal (24/7)

Don’t wait until it’s too late to address water damage. Here are some warning signs that you need emergency water remov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ty or mildewy smell in your home, it’s likely a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, address the issue immediately to prevent further damage. Don’t wait until the problem gets worse.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your floors are no longer level or have become soft to the touch, it’s likely a sign of a larger issue. Don’t delay, address the issue now.

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Water stains on the ceiling can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ore it, address the issue immediately to prevent further dam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your paint or wallpaper is peeling or bubbling, it’s likely a sign of a larger issue. Don’t delay, address the issue now.

Soft or Sagging Walls

Soft or sagging wal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your walls are no longer firm or have become soft to the touch, it’s likely a sign of a larger issue. Don’t wait until the problem gets worse.

Water Damage on Your Belongings

Water damage can affect not just your home, but also your belongings. If you notice that your furniture, carpets, or other belongings have been damaged by water, it’s likely a sign of a larger issue. Don’t delay, address the issue now.

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Cost in Corinth, TX

The cost of emergency water removal can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Corinth, TX.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after assessing the damage, and we’ll work closely with your insurance company to ensure that you’re covered.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 The amount of water to be extracted, the size of the affected area, and the complexity of the job.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the length of time required to dry the area.
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the level of contamination.
Final inspection and touch-ups $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of damage.
Emergency water removal (24/7) $1,500 – $10,000 The severity and size of the affected area, the complexity of the job, and the equipment needed.
Insurance claim support $0 – $500 The complexity of the claim and the level of support needed.
